Bridge Street Toys Builds Business with Robust, Reliable NAS Solution from Intel and EMC
The popular toy company Bridge Street Toys needed a dependable and affordable backup solution to reduce storage networking complexity and potential data loss. They chose the Intel® Entry Storage System SS4200-E powered by EMC Lifeline* software to centralize and safeguard business assets. This case study shows how the right combination of performance, simplicity, and value put Bridge Street Toys back in control with systematic backup, out-of-the-box RAID, and instant access across the network.
